Win or Lose
Win or Lose
TV2025

Win or Lose

Loading ratings...

As a championship game looms, eight characters are thrown a curveball in their off-the-field lives.

Released: 2025Category: tvStatus: EndedLanguage: English
More info

My Followings Reviews

Others Reviews